### Step 4: Configure the restock planner secret (Cartwheel Vend)

Before your plugin can query the Cartwheel restock planner, the host process must authenticate to the planner API. Plugins never handle this credential directly; the host injects it at runtime. On the deployment machine, open the planner's env file and append the signing secret on the following line.

env line for fafof-fahag: LEDGER_TOKEN5=f8790

Hey — quick handover from Priya to Tomás on SDK parity. The Quillwork Android SDK finally matches iOS on offline caching and retry policies, but batch uploads still lag behind. New folks: don't assume a feature exists on both sides just because the docs say so. We track every gap in a living matrix, updated weekly. You'll find it at the page linked below.

dashboard of baweg-bawip = https://kibana.qirvancloud.test/run/projects/job/secrets/503e59c4ba058b95

Handover note — Crumbwheel order cutoffs.

Welcome aboard. The bakery cutoff rule in Crumbwheel closes same-day orders at 14:00 local to each storefront, not UTC — this has bitten us twice. Holiday overrides live in the calendar service and take precedence silently, so always check there first when a cutoff looks wrong. To unlock the calendar service's admin console after a restart, enter the recovery passphrase below.

vault phrase of bagap-bahaf = silion-pelox-sorox-casdor-quenwyn-fraax-eliox-praael-kelion-quenvan-kasox-rusael-norius-belvan

## Relevance Tuning

Boost weights for the Thornquay search stack live in rank_config.toml. Reviewers: reject changes that alter title boost and recency decay in the same patch. Run the offline eval harness against the golden query set; NDCG delta must stay within 0.02. Harness results post to the Bellmarsh metrics service, which requires auth on every write. The harness reads its credential from the environment; set it to the key below.

API key for yahig-tadup: kto7_ubizbYm

Subject: Quickstore 4.2 — bloom filter now fronts the KV layer

Plugin authors: starting with this release, Quickstore places a bloom filter ahead of the key-value store. Negative lookups return faster; false positives fall through safely. No API changes are required on your side. Verify your plugin against the staging build referenced below.

session token of fahif-tadup = htk3_9c7